Illinois Child Abduction Leads to ATV Chase, Child Endangerment Charges

Hurst, IL – A dramatic sequence of events unfolded in Hurst, Illinois, on Tuesday culminating in the arrest of Ricky A. Cooper following a dangerous ATV chase involving a 3-year-old child. 

Williamson County Sheriff’s deputies reports say deputies attempted to stop Cooper, who was seen reportedly driving the ATV without safety helmets for himself or the child, on public roads. Cooper, familiar to the deputies from prior interactions, reportedly fled, ignoring stop signs, leading to a pursuit that was eventually terminated to safeguard the child’s well-being.

The investigation revealed Cooper, the biological but non-custodial father, had allegedly taken the child from the grandparents’ custody without permission. The child was safely returned to his grandmother later that evening, after Cooper indicated his willingness to surrender. He also admitted the ATV was stolen, sparking an ongoing search for the vehicle.

Cooper now faces multiple charges, including Aggravated Fleeing and Eluding a Peace Officer, Child Abduction, and Endangering the Life or Health of a Child. The Williamson County Sheriff’s Office urges anyone with information to come forward, offering anonymity through their tip submission app.
